During the International Olympic Committee (IOC) awards ceremony, former Jordanian Olympic champion, Samar Nassar, was granted the “Winner for Asia” title in the 3rd IOC Women and Sports Award, which took place in Buenos Aires, Argentine.

Nassar, who is a two-time Olympic swimmer (2000 and 2004), won the award for her efforts in enriching women’s role in sports, including establishing football programs for Syrian girls at the Zaatari refugee camp in Jordan.

A member of the Jordanian Olympic Committee (JOC), Nassar released a press statement after she received the award on Saturday, October 6, 2018, expressing her happiness and stressing her commitment to further serve sports, both locally and internationally.

"I am very proud of this award," Nassar said. "This is an achievement for Jordan, which is constantly keen to create a legacy in sport through its own children... I thank everyone for their support and I will strive to continue promoting the concept of sport."
